手游网站开发,企业官网营销推广,成都网站备案太慢,在线编辑图片的网站有哪些获取input有两种方法#xff1a;
第一#xff1a;bindsubmit方法 注意#xff1a; 1.使用form里面定义bindsubmit事件 2.bindsubmit事件需要配合button里面定义的formType“submit” 操作 3.设置input的name值来获取对应的数据
form bindsubmitformSubmit…获取input有两种方法
第一bindsubmit方法 注意 1.使用form里面定义bindsubmit事件 2.bindsubmit事件需要配合button里面定义的formType“submit” 操作 3.设置input的name值来获取对应的数据
form bindsubmitformSubmitinput typetext namename classcontent placeholder请输入司机姓名 /input typetext nameplateNo classcontent placeholder请输入车牌号 /button classwehx-foot-btn hover-classwehx-button_hover formTypesubmit确定/button
/form通过e.detail.value获取数据, 其中包含input的value值
formSubmit: function (e) {console.log(e.detail.value)let name data.detail.value.namelet plateNo data.detail.value.plateNo;
}第二种bindinput方法 注意 1.在input框内使用bindinput属性的方式定义事件名称 2.事件是光标移动发生数据改变数据自动获取
input typetext bindinputgetInputName namename classcontent placeholder请输入司机姓名 /通过e.detail获取数据 其中包含input的value值、光标的位置cursor
getInputName:function(e){console.log(e.detail)// 获取到input的值let name e.detail.value;// 获取到光标的位置let local e.detail.cursor;
}参考微信小程序之 获取input框输入值
form表单提交
form bindsubmitformSubmit bindresetformResetview classsection section_gapview classsection__title是否公开信息/viewswitch nameisPub //viewview classsectionview classsection__title手机号/viewinput namephone placeholder手机号 //viewview classsectionview classsection__title密码/viewinput namepwd placeholder密码 password//viewview classsection section_gapview classsection__title性别/viewradio-group namesexlabelradio value男 checked/男/labellabelradio value女 /女/label/radio-group/viewview classbtn-areabutton formTypesubmit提交/buttonbutton formTypereset重置/button/view
/form
view wx:if{{isSubmit}}{{warn ? warn : 是否公开信息isPub手机号phone密码pwd性别sex}}
/view.section{display: flex;flex-direction: row;margin: 20rpx;
}
.section view{margin-right: 20rpx;
}
.btn-area{margin: 20rpx;
}
button{margin: 10rpx 0;
}let app getApp();
Page({data: {isSubmit: false,warn: ,phone: ,pwd: ,isPub: false,sex: 男},formSubmit: function (e) {console.log(form发生了submit事件携带数据为, e.detail.value);let { phone, pwd, isPub, sex } e.detail.value;if (!phone || !pwd) {this.setData({warn: 手机号或密码为空,isSubmit: true})return;}this.setData({warn: ,isSubmit: true,phone,pwd,isPub,sex})},formReset: function () {console.log(form发生了reset事件)}
})参考微信小程序-form表单提交
注意几个点 实现过程分为以下几步 1.给 form 表单设置 bindsubmit 属性。 2.给所有 input / check等等项 设置 name 属性 (否则无法获取值) 3.给按钮设置 form-typesubmit”与第一步 form 设置的 bindsubmit 属性值 绑定 4.编写按钮触发的函数 (第一步与第三步共同绑定的